无论是为了防范突如其来的硬件故障、恶意软件攻击,还是简单的误操作导致的数据丢失,定期且有效的数据备份策略都是保护数据安全、确保业务连续性的基石
在众多备份方案中,批处理RAR备份指定日期文件的方法,以其高效、灵活和低成本的特点,赢得了广泛的认可和应用
本文将深入探讨这一备份策略的重要性、实施步骤、优化技巧及其在实际应用中的显著优势
一、批处理RAR备份的重要性 1. 自动化与效率 手动备份文件不仅耗时费力,而且容易出错
通过批处理脚本,我们可以自动化地完成文件的筛选、压缩和存储过程,大大提高备份效率,减少人为错误
特别是对于大型数据集或需要频繁备份的场景,自动化备份显得尤为重要
2. 灵活性与定制化 批处理脚本允许用户根据实际需求灵活设置备份条件,如指定日期、文件类型、大小限制等
这种高度定制化能力确保了备份策略能够精准匹配不同的业务需求和法规要求
3. 成本效益 相比专业的备份软件或服务,利用Windows自带的批处理功能和免费的RAR压缩工具,可以大幅度降低备份成本
对于预算有限的小型企业或个人用户而言,这无疑是一个极具吸引力的选择
4. 数据安全 RAR格式以其强大的压缩算法和加密功能著称,能够有效减少存储空间占用,同时保护备份数据免受未经授权的访问
定期备份结合RAR加密,为数据安全提供了双重保障
二、实施步骤 1. 准备工具 - RAR压缩软件:确保系统上已安装WinRAR或类似的RAR压缩工具,且命令行版本(如rar.exe)可用
- 批处理脚本编辑器:使用记事本、Notepad++等文本编辑器编写批处理脚本(.bat文件)
2. 编写批处理脚本 以下是一个示例脚本,用于备份指定日期(例如,每天备份前一天的文件)的文件到指定目录,并使用RAR压缩: @echo off setlocal :: 设置变量 set source_dir=C:pathtosource :: 源文件目录 set backup_dir=D:pathtobackup :: 备份目录 set backup_date=%date:~-10,4%%date:~-5,2%%date:~-2% :: 获取当前日期的前一天(YYYYMMDD格式) set archive_name=backup_%backup_date%.rar :: 压缩文件名 :: 创建备份目录(如果不存在) if not exist %backup_dir% mkdir %backup_dir% :: 筛选指定日期的文件并压缩 cd /d %source_dir% forfiles /S /M- . /D -1 /C cmd /c if @isdir==FALSE rar a -r -ep1 %backup_dir%%archive_name% @path :: 输出备份完成信息 echo Backup completed: %backup_dir%%archive_name% endlocal pause 说明: - `forfiles`命令用于筛选指定日期(前一天)的文件
- `rar a -r -ep1`命令用于递归添加文件到RAR压缩包中,`-ep1`参数设置加密密码(此处省略,实际应用中应设置)
- `%date%`变量的格式可能因系统区域设置而异,需根据实际情况调整日期提取逻辑
3. 执行与测试 保存脚本为`.bat`文件,双击运行进行测试
检查备份目录中的RAR文件,确认指定日期的文件已被正确备份且压缩
4. 计划任务 为了实现定期自动备份,可将批处理脚本添加到Windows任务计划程序中
设置触发器(如每天特定时间)来自动执行备份任务,确保数据持续得到保护
三、优化技巧 1. 日志记录 在脚本中添加日志记录功能,记录每次备份的详细信息,包括成功备份的文件、遇到的错误等
这有助于后续的问题排查和性能监控
2. 错误处理 增强脚本的错误处理能力,如检查源文件目录是否存在、RAR命令执行是否成功等,并在遇到错误时发送通知或采取其他补救措施
3. 备份轮换 设定备份保留策略,如只保留最近7天的备份,以节省存储空间
可通过脚本删除过期的备份文件或压缩包
4. 网络备份 对于需要异地备份的场景,可将备份文件通过FTP、SFTP等方式传输到远程服务器,进一步增强数据安全性
四、实际应用中的显著优势 1. 提升业务连续性 自动化备份确保了数据的持续可用性,即使发生意外情况,也能迅速恢复业务运行,减少停机时间和数据丢失风险
2. 符合合规要求 许多行业和法规要求定期备份数据
批处理RAR备份方案提供了一种简单有效的方式来满足这些合规要求
3. 增强团队协作 通过集中管理和自动化备份,IT团队可以专注于更重要的任务,而无需频繁手动干预备份流程,提升了团队整体效率
4. 促进数据治理 定期备份不仅保护了当前数据,还为历史数据分析、审计等提供了基础
批处理备份方案使得数据回溯变得更加容易和高效
结语 批处理RAR备份指定日期文件的方法,以其高效、灵活、低成本的特点,成为了众多组织和个人的首选备份策略
通过精心设计和不断优化,这一方案不仅能够满足基本的备份需求,还能在业务连续性、合规性、团队协作和数据治理等方面发挥重要作用
在数字化转型加速的今天,掌握并应用好这一技术,对于保障数据安全、推动业务发展具有重要意义
让我们携手并进,共同构建一个更加安全、高效的数据管理环境